Kasuo Electronics Launches Advanced Testing Laboratory to Strengthen Global Supply Chain Quality Assurance
April 29, 2025 | BUSINESS WIREEstimated reading time: Less than a minute
Kasuo Electronics Co., Ltd, a globally recognized trader of electronic components, has officially operationalized its state-of-the-art testing laboratory. This milestone underscores the company’s commitment to elevating quality control in the global supply chain, offering enhanced validation services for integrated circuits, diodes, transistors, and other critical components.
Equipped with cutting-edge testing systems, the laboratory provides comprehensive analysis of component performance, compatibility, and reliability. It addresses complex industrial and automotive applications, such as stability verification of high-current circuit breakers and troubleshooting compatibility issues in legacy systems. Additionally, the lab delivers tailored solutions for rare or specialized components, ensuring traceability and compliance with client specifications.
“Quality is the cornerstone of trust in electronic component trading,” said CEO Jayden Zheng. “This laboratory not only guarantees that every component meets rigorous standards but also positions us as a one-stop partner for technical consulting and after-sales support, reinforcing our pivotal role in the global supply chain.”
Moving forward, Kasuo Electronics will continue to advance the laboratory’s capabilities and foster collaboration across the industry, solidifying its reputation as the most reliable bridge in global electronic component trade.
